Session Introduction:
Education is evolving beyond the traditional “Reading, wRiting, and aRithmetic.” In today’s dynamic world, the new three Rs—Reconnect, Reengage, and Reimagine—are at the heart of meaningful learning. This session will explore how educators can rebuild relationships, reignite learner engagement, and reimagine their practice to meet the needs of a changing educational landscape.
Learning Objectives:
1. Understand the importance of reconnecting with students to foster a supportive and inclusive learning environment.
2. Explore strategies to reengage learners by creating purposeful and relevant classroom experiences.
3. Identify opportunities to reimagine teaching through innovation, creativity, and responsiveness to future learning needs.
About Instructor
Prof. Abbas Husain, Director Teachers’ Development Centre, leads a team of teacher trainers and has so far reached over 85,000 teachers in schools of every variety in the country. He is one of the founding members of SPELT and has participated in all international conferences from 1987 to date. He holds a Master’s Degree in English Literature from University of Karachi and a M.Ed. TESOL from University of Manchester. In 2020, he received the Lifetime Achievement Award by Millennium Institute of Professional Development presented by Mohsin e Pakistan Dr. A. Q. Khan.
